Families need child tax credit

Supporting families through our tax code can minimize harm. I would know. During the pandemic, my family lost our primary source of income. We all felt how hard it was to meet our basic needs. We got support through the expanded child tax credit, which helped us make ends meet. It got us through the pandemic, and when it was reduced, we felt that financial impact, too.

When the government cut off tax credit expansion, the reality of its effects was more than realized by those who relied on it as a source of sustainability. The impact has been too much for families. Child poverty more than doubled last year, according to recent Census data

Instead of fighting, Congress should refocus on the people’s priorities, not the political preferences of its members. I urge our congressional delegation to be the consumer’s voice, get our children out of poverty, and keep them out of poverty by expanding the child tax credit. We, the people, have a voice, and we need to be heard. Our security can be found when our growing fear of lack is over.
